Re: Distance from Wallington Girls High School
The way that I read the admissions policy was that the 80 places will be allocated on score as well, but will only look at the scores of those girls that live within the 6.7km distance criteria.Booklady wrote:We want to assess how likely she would be to get one of the 80 in catchment places based on her distance (the top 100 go on score).
(from admissions policy)Up to 80 places in order of highest score to those whose permanent place of residence on the closing date for applications within the Pan-London Co-ordinated Secondary Admissions Scheme in the year prior to admission is within a 6.7km radius of the main entrance to the school building.

Re: Distance from Wallington Girls High School
80 places are also on score, but for those who are in catchment. Distance comes into play in case of tie (see 4.7).
The sentence about distance in 4.4.4 is confusing and perhaps should not have been included in that clause.
Both the School and Sutton Council do not give info about the cut-off scores. May be some one with some letter from school giving scores may be able to help.
